Charles River Watershed Association and Indigenous Peoples Day Newton: 4th Annual Quinobequin Intertribal Paddle, Jun. 27

On Saturday, June 27 from 10:00 AM to 2:00 PM at Newton’s Historic Boathouse (2401 Commonwealth Ave, Auburndale), Charles River Watershed Association (CRWA) and Indigenous Peoples Day (IPD) Newton will host the fourth annual Quinobequin Intertribal Paddle: a relaxing midday paddle on one of the most beautiful stretches of the…

Newton Porchfest 2026, Jun. 6

Newton PorchFest will be held on Saturday, June 6, 12-6PM (rain or shine!), with free music by performers playing in over 50 locations across Auburndale, Lower Falls, Waban Center, and West Newton. All events are free and open to the public. View the schedule and map here. Questions? Want to…

Mural at Auburndale Library honors memory of beloved community member Kirby Green Grochal

In the children’s room of the Auburndale Community Library on a February afternoon, artist Mia Cross worked on a mural honoring Kirby Green Grochal, a beloved community member, daughter, and mother who died in May 2023. On Sunday, April 12, the community will gather for the grand opening of this…
